# ollama-gfx906/Dockerfile
|
|
||||||
#
|
|
||||||
# Custom ollama image with ROCm 6.1 + gfx906 (MI50) support.
|
|
||||||
# The official ollama/rocm image ships ROCm 7.2 which dropped gfx906.
|
|
||||||
# This uses v0.23.2's native CMake build system with AMDGPU_TARGETS including gfx906.
|
|
||||||
#
|
|
||||||
# Build: docker build -t ollama/ollama:rocm-gfx906 ai/ollama
|
|
||||||
|
|
||||||
FROM rocm/dev-ubuntu-22.04:6.1.2-complete AS builder
|
|
||||||
|
|
||||||
# Build dependencies (CMake, Ninja, Go)
|
|
||||||
ARG CMAKEVERSION=3.31.2
|
|
||||||
ARG NINJAVERSION=1.12.1
|
|
||||||
ARG GOLANG_VERSION=1.22.0
|
|
||||||
|
|
||||||
RUN apt-get update && DEBIAN_FRONTEND=noninteractive apt-get install -y \
|
|
||||||
curl git ccache build-essential pkg-config unzip \
|
|
||||||
&& rm -rf /var/lib/apt/lists/*
|
|
||||||
|
|
||||||
# Install CMake from official binaries
|
|
||||||
RUN curl -fsSL https://github.com/Kitware/CMake/releases/download/v${CMAKEVERSION}/cmake-${CMAKEVERSION}-linux-x86_64.tar.gz \
|
|
||||||
| tar xz -C /usr/local --strip-components 1
|
|
||||||
|
|
||||||
# Install Ninja
|
|
||||||
RUN curl -fsSL -o /tmp/ninja.zip \
|
|
||||||
https://github.com/ninja-build/ninja/releases/download/v${NINJAVERSION}/ninja-linux.zip \
|
|
||||||
&& unzip /tmp/ninja.zip -d /usr/local/bin && rm /tmp/ninja.zip
|
|
||||||
|
|
||||||
# Install Go
|
|
||||||
RUN curl -fsSL https://go.dev/dl/go${GOLANG_VERSION}.linux-amd64.tar.gz \
|
|
||||||
| tar xz -C /usr/local
|
|
||||||
ENV PATH=/usr/local/go/bin:$PATH
|
|
||||||
|
|
||||||
ARG OLLAMA_VERSION=v0.23.2
|
|
||||||
RUN git clone --depth 1 --branch ${OLLAMA_VERSION} https://github.com/ollama/ollama.git /build
|
|
||||||
WORKDIR /build
|
|
||||||
|
|
||||||
# ROCm paths
|
|
||||||
ENV HIP_PATH=/opt/rocm
|
|
||||||
ENV ROCM_PATH=/opt/rocm
|
|
||||||
ENV CMAKE_GENERATOR=Ninja
|
|
||||||
ENV LDFLAGS=-s
|
|
||||||
|
|
||||||
# Step 1: Build CPU backends with GCC (no ROCm preset)
|
|
||||||
# Pre-set CMAKE_HIP_COMPILER="" to prevent check_language(HIP) from
|
|
||||||
# finding a HIP compiler (it searches /opt/rocm even without PATH).
|
|
||||||
# Remove /opt/rocm from PATH to prevent find_program from finding hipcc.
|
|
||||||
RUN mkdir -p build-cpu && \
|
|
||||||
PATH=/usr/local/go/bin:/usr/local/sbin:/usr/local/bin:/usr/sbin:/usr/bin:/sbin:/bin \
|
|
||||||
cmake -B build-cpu -DCMAKE_BUILD_TYPE=Release \
|
|
||||||
-DCMAKE_HIP_COMPILER="" \
|
|
||||||
-DCMAKE_INSTALL_PREFIX=/build/dist && \
|
|
||||||
cmake --build build-cpu --target ggml-cpu -- -l $(nproc) && \
|
|
||||||
cmake --install build-cpu --component CPU --strip && \
|
|
||||||
echo "=== CPU install ===" && \
|
|
||||||
(find /build/dist/lib/ollama -type f -o -type l 2>&1 | head -20 || echo "empty")
|
|
||||||
|
|
||||||
# Step 2: Build HIP backend with ROCm preset + gfx906 target only
|
|
||||||
# The ROCm 6 preset enables HIP language detection (enable_language(HIP))
|
|
||||||
# which ensures GPU kernels are properly compiled for gfx906.
|
|
||||||
# OLLAMA_RUNNER_DIR=rocm from the preset, so HIP goes to lib/ollama/rocm/
|
|
||||||
# Need CMAKE_PREFIX_PATH so find_package(hip) finds hip-config.cmake
|
|
||||||
# at /opt/rocm/lib/cmake/hip/hip-config.cmake.
|
|
||||||
RUN mkdir -p build-hip && \
|
|
||||||
cmake -B build-hip \
|
|
||||||
--preset 'ROCm 6' \
|
|
||||||
-DAMDGPU_TARGETS="gfx906:xnack-" \
|
|
||||||
-DCMAKE_BUILD_TYPE=Release \
|
|
||||||
-DCMAKE_PREFIX_PATH="/opt/rocm" && \
|
|
||||||
cmake --build build-hip --target ggml-hip -- -l $(nproc) && \
|
|
||||||
cmake --install build-hip --component HIP --strip && \
|
|
||||||
echo "=== HIP install ===" && \
|
|
||||||
find /build/dist/lib/ollama -type f -o -type l | head -20
|
|
||||||
|
|
||||||
# Step 3: Build Go binary (GCC for CGo linking)
|
|
||||||
ENV CGO_ENABLED=1
|
|
||||||
RUN go build -trimpath -ldflags="-X=github.com/ollama/ollama/version.Version=${OLLAMA_VERSION}" -o /build/dist/ollama .
|
|
||||||
|
|
||||||
# ---------- Runtime image ----------
|
|
||||||
FROM ubuntu:24.04
|
|
||||||
|
|
||||||
RUN apt-get update && DEBIAN_FRONTEND=noninteractive apt-get install -y \
|
|
||||||
ca-certificates curl libstdc++6 libgomp1 libvulkan1 libopenblas0 \
|
|
||||||
&& rm -rf /var/lib/apt/lists/*
|
|
||||||
|
|
||||||
# Copy ROCm 6.1 runtime libraries
|
|
||||||
# These are needed at runtime by ggml-hip via LD_LIBRARY_PATH
|
|
||||||
COPY --from=builder /opt/rocm/lib/ /opt/rocm/lib/
|
|
||||||
COPY --from=builder /opt/rocm/share/ /opt/rocm/share/
|
|
||||||
|
|
||||||
# Copy ollama binary + all backends (CPU + HIP)
|
|
||||||
# CPU install: /build/dist/lib/ollama/libggml-*.so
|
|
||||||
# HIP install: /build/dist/lib/ollama/rocm/libggml-hip.so
|
|
||||||
COPY --from=builder /build/dist/ollama /usr/bin/ollama
|
|
||||||
COPY --from=builder /build/dist/lib/ollama/ /usr/lib/ollama/
|
|
||||||
|
|
||||||
RUN ldconfig
|
|
||||||
|
|
||||||
ENV LD_LIBRARY_PATH=/opt/rocm/lib:/usr/lib/ollama/rocm:/usr/lib/ollama
|
|
||||||
ENV HSA_OVERRIDE_GFX_VERSION=9.0.6
|
|
||||||
ENV HCC_AMDGPU_TARGET=gfx906
|
|
||||||
ENV HSA_ENABLE_SDMA=0
|
|
||||||
|
|
||||||
EXPOSE 11434
|
|
||||||
ENTRYPOINT ["/bin/ollama"]
|
|
||||||
CMD ["serve"]

# AI Worker Restricted Access
|
|
||||||
|
|
||||||
This module provides SSH access for the AI worker (hermes-agent) to run ollama benchmarks on the host.
|
|
||||||
|
|
||||||
## Security Model
|
|
||||||
|
|
||||||
The `ai-worker` user has:
|
|
||||||
|
|
||||||
### Filesystem Access
|
|
||||||
- **Home directory**: `/home/ai-worker` (standard user home)
|
|
||||||
- **No bind mounts**: Cannot access `/home/gortium/infra` or other host files
|
|
||||||
- **Cannot access**: Any files outside standard system paths
|
|
||||||
|
|
||||||
### Sudo Access
|
|
||||||
- **NONE**: ai-worker has no sudo privileges
|
|
||||||
- Cannot run `nh`, `nixos-rebuild`, `nixpkgs-fmt`, or `nix` with elevated permissions
|
|
||||||
|
|
||||||
### Docker Access
|
|
||||||
- Member of `docker` group - can run `docker` and `docker exec` commands
|
|
||||||
- Primary use: `docker exec ollama ollama ...` for benchmarking
|
|
||||||
- Can run `docker exec --privileged ollama rocm-smi ...` for VRAM monitoring
|
|
||||||
|
|
||||||
## Workflow: SSH + Docker Benchmarking
|
|
||||||
|
|
||||||
The AI worker connects from the Hermes container to the host via SSH, runs ollama benchmarks, then returns to save results.
